当前位置: 首页 > news >正文

定兴做网站网站seo李守洪排名大师

定兴做网站,网站seo李守洪排名大师,网站开发与服务器交互,网站建设倒计时代码题目链接 活动 - AcWing本课程系统讲解常用算法与数据结构的应用方式与技巧。https://www.acwing.com/problem/content/1252/ 题解 当两个点已经是在同一个连通块中,再连一条边,就围成一个封闭的圈。一般用x * n y的形式将(x, y&#xff0…

题目链接

活动 - AcWing本课程系统讲解常用算法与数据结构的应用方式与技巧。icon-default.png?t=N7T8https://www.acwing.com/problem/content/1252/

题解

当两个点已经是在同一个连通块中,再连一条边,就围成一个封闭的圈。一般用x * n + y的形式将(x, y)变成一维。

代码

#include <cstdio>
#include <cstring>
#include <iostream>
#include <algorithm>using namespace std;const int N = 40010;int n, m;
int p[N];int get(int x, int y)
{return x * n + y;
}int find(int x)
{if (p[x] != x) p[x] = find(p[x]);return p[x];
}int main()
{cin >> n >> m;for (int i = 0; i < n * n; i++) p[i] = i;int res = 0;for (int i = 1; i <= m; i++){int x, y;char d;cin >> x >> y >> d;x--, y--;int a = get(x, y);int b;if (d == 'D') b = get(x + 1, y);else b = get(x, y + 1);int pa = find(a), pb = find(b);if (pa == pb){res = i;break;}p[pa] = pb;}if (!res) puts("draw");else cout << res << endl;return 0;
}

参考资料

  1. AcWing算法提高课
http://www.yidumall.com/news/20207.html

相关文章:

  • 程序员开源网站活动软文怎么写
  • 媒体平台推广网站用户体验优化
  • 淘宝上做网站 源代码怎么给你何鹏seo
  • 东莞网站建设 兼职免费seo工具
  • 政府网站开发报价建立网站的流程
  • 网站建设犭金手指a排名15百度竞价代理公司
  • 云南大学做行测的网站补习班
  • 餐饮管理系统哪个好冯宗耀seo教程
  • 个人做的网站有什么危险网络舆情监测系统
  • 网站建好了怎么做十大品牌营销策划公司
  • 网站制作图片插入代码免费个人网站平台
  • 织梦大气蓝色门户资讯网站模板金华百度seo
  • 个人网站还用备案吗百度怎么做广告
  • 小程序注册商标第几类百度seo文章
  • 做网站 php j2ee上海营销公司
  • 手机凡客网上海专业的seo推广咨询电话
  • 自己做壁纸的网站网络营销与直播电商是干什么的
  • 珠海建网站百度竞价排名商业模式
  • 手机app wap网站模板下载网络营销的四大特点
  • 做网站到底要不要备案谷歌关键词热度查询
  • 怎么样更好的做网站千锋教育北京校区
  • 深圳做企业网站的公司推荐创建网址快捷方式
  • 群晖 同步 wordpress站长工具seo综合查询引流
  • 广东省住房和建设局网站定制建站网站建设
  • 杨凌网站开发今日重大军事新闻
  • 免费给我推广湖北百度seo排名
  • 武汉网站建设供应商百度搜索引擎投放
  • 苏州网站建设设计公司网络广告策划
  • wordpress修改地址后网站打不开新闻头条 今天
  • 武汉交友群正规网站优化哪个公司好